Passmark

Passmark CPU Mark is a widespread benchmark, consisting of 8 different types of workload, including integer and floating point math, extended instructions, compression, encryption and physics calculation. There is also one separate single-threaded scenario measuring single-core performance. Other than that, Passmark measures multi-core performance.

Xeon X5492 has a 1.7% higher aggregate performance score.

Xeon X5470, on the other hand, has an age advantage of 2 months, and 25% lower power consumption.

Given the minimal performance differences, no clear winner can be declared between Intel Xeon X5492 and Intel Xeon X5470.
